Sometimes the universe has a sense of humor...

Yesterday started like any other day in my workshop. I was preparing a fresh batch of my herbal, crystal-infused wax melt tarts, carefully measuring out the tiny 2-5mm crystals that give each tart its unique metaphysical properties. The morning sun was streaming through the windows, my favorite essential oil blends were filling the air, and I was feeling perfectly zen.

Then it happened.

The Great Crystal Catastrophe of July 13, 2025.

One moment I was reaching for my favorite mixing bowl, and the next... CRASH! Every single container of crystals I had so carefully sorted and prepared went tumbling to the floor. Amethyst chips, rose quartz fragments, clear quartz pieces, citrine bits – all of them scattered across my workshop floor like the world's most expensive confetti.

I stood there for a moment, just staring at the sparkling chaos at my feet, and I'll be honest – I may have said a few words that definitely weren't metaphysically aligned with love and light.

Finding the Silver Lining (Or Should I Say, Crystal Lining?)

After the initial shock wore off, I did what any reasonable person would do: I got down on my hands and knees and started the great crystal recovery mission. Armed with a magnifying glass, tweezers, and the patience of a saint, I began the painstaking process of sorting through hundreds of tiny crystals.

But here's what struck me as I was crawling around my workshop floor – this mishap actually reminded me why I'm so passionate about what I do. Each of those tiny crystals represents intention, energy, and the natural beauty that goes into every single wax melt tart I create.

The Deeper Meaning

As I sorted through amethyst meant for calming blends and citrine destined for abundance tarts, I realized this little accident was actually a beautiful metaphor. Sometimes life scatters our carefully laid plans, but that doesn't mean the magic is lost – it just means we need to approach it differently.

Every crystal I picked up had been cleansed and charged with intention. That energy doesn't disappear just because they took an unexpected journey to my workshop floor. In fact, maybe they needed that grounding experience (literally!).
